logo

Output 58175106a200a756e82e99f5673c4577b1a495a6ad1069160d8b7c0169be163c:8

value
27560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f71c60e62243da5e1b03dfab2f49128a888497d9 OP_EQUAL
address
3QDcphX6avukMm1uUy6xhQ6FX7DvxU5fmq
transaction
58175106a200a756e82e99f5673c4577b1a495a6ad1069160d8b7c0169be163c